[calm - Cygwin server-side packaging maintenance script] branch master, updated. 0782de43170a1a81f0cb51ea83e60a0b53b28c6b




https://sourceware.org/git/gitweb.cgi?p=cygwin-apps/calm.git;h=0782de43170a1a81f0cb51ea83e60a0b53b28c6b

commit 0782de43170a1a81f0cb51ea83e60a0b53b28c6b
Author: Jon Turney <jon.turney@dronecode.org.uk>
Date:   Fri Mar 18 16:47:40 2016 +0000

    Write detailed calm log output to a file
    
    Also write detailed calm log output to a file
    Rotate this log file on each run
    Send normal output to stdout, rather than stderr
    Downgrade a verycommon message from update_package_listings() to DEBUG

@@ -163,10 +164,28 @@ if __name__ == "__main__":
     parser.add_argument('-v', '--verbose', action='count', dest='verbose', help='verbose output')
     (args) = parser.parse_args()
 
+    # set up logging to a file
+    try:
+        os.makedirs('/var/log/cygwin/', exist_ok=True)
+    except FileExistsError:
+        pass
+    rfh = logging.handlers.RotatingFileHandler('/var/log/cygwin/calm.log', backupCount=24)
+    rfh.doRollover()  # force a rotate on every run
+    rfh.setFormatter(logging.Formatter('%(asctime)s - %(levelname)-8s - %(message)s'))
+    rfh.setLevel(logging.INFO)
+    logging.getLogger().addHandler(rfh)
+
+    # setup logging to stdout, of WARNING messages or higher (INFO if verbose)
+    ch = logging.StreamHandler(sys.stdout)
+    ch.setFormatter(logging.Formatter(os.path.basename(sys.argv[0])+': %(message)s'))
     if args.verbose:
-        logging.getLogger().setLevel(logging.INFO)
+        ch.setLevel(logging.INFO)
+    else:
+        ch.setLevel(logging.WARNING)
+    logging.getLogger().addHandler(ch)
 
-    logging.basicConfig(format=os.path.basename(sys.argv[0])+': %(message)s')
+    # change root logger level from the default of WARNING
+    logging.getLogger().setLevel(logging.INFO)
 
     if args.email:
         args.email = args.email.split(',')
